Red Hair Well
Located in the rear of the Chunhua art museum (once Chun Shan Hall), Red Hair Well is already three hundred years old, which is the only one aged well from Netherlands left in the middle Taiwan. When the Taiwan was occupied by the Netherlands, many preachers and soldiers came to draw water to drink. Therefore, the locals call this well “ Red Hair Well ” or “Barbarian well”.
Besides offering the drink for the locals around, the pond water is also used for making tea because of its sweet taste. There is mat shed erected around and inside it worships the Fu Da God. It can be realized that drinking water think of its source by doing this (the information resource is from the Chunhua City traveling guarding book of Chunhua City administrator 2006).
